Just curious. What types of sensor ships have you guys made? And how do you deploy them? Ive only played a handful of games and the types of sensor platforms I have made werent that great, they had a 7 parsec sensor range. I deployed them to cover any defense holes I had around my borders and to cover any approaches to my main planets and Earth. The sensor ships where not armed either.
